Course Content

• Aquatic Therapy Techniques and Modalities
• Exercise Prescription for Aquatic Rehabilitation
• Hydrostatic Pressure and its Therapeutic Applications
• Assessment and Evaluation in Aquatic Rehabilitation
• Program Design and Implementation for Aquatic Rehabilitation
• Patient Management and Communication Skills
• Safety and Risk Management in Aquatic Environments
• Anatomy and Physiology for Aquatic Therapists
• Business and Professional Development for Aquatic Rehabilitation (Marketing, Practice Management)
• Aquatic Rehabilitation for Specific Populations (e.g., Geriatrics, Pediatrics)

Career path

Career Advancement Programme in Aquatic Rehabilitation: UK Job Market Outlook

Job Role Description
Aquatic Therapist (Primary: Aquatic; Secondary: Rehabilitation) Delivering evidence-based aquatic therapy programs to diverse client groups. Strong focus on patient assessment and treatment planning in a pool environment.
Senior Aquatic Physiotherapist (Primary: Physiotherapy, Aquatic; Secondary: Rehabilitation, Management) Leading a team, mentoring junior staff, and providing expert aquatic physiotherapy interventions to complex cases. Overseeing clinic operations and ensuring high standards of care.
Aquatic Rehabilitation Manager (Primary: Management, Aquatic; Secondary: Rehabilitation, Business) Managing the operational and financial aspects of an aquatic rehabilitation facility. Strategic planning, staff supervision, and service development in this niche field.
Research Scientist in Aquatic Therapy (Primary: Research, Aquatic; Secondary: Rehabilitation, Science) Conducting research to advance aquatic rehabilitation techniques and technologies. Analyzing data, publishing findings, and contributing to the field's evidence base.
